COGNICASE Reports 148 Percent Increase in net Earnings for Second Quarter of Fiscal 1999 APRIL 29, 1999 MONTREAL, QUEBEC--COGNICASE Inc. (Nasdaq: "COGI") today announced results for the second quarter and first six months ended March 31, 1999. All dollar amounts are expressed in U.S. dollars. Revenues increased 249 percent to US$36,028,000 in the second quarter of fiscal 1999 compared to US$10,319,000 in the corresponding period in 1998. Net earnings excluding unrealized foreign exchange gains and losses rose 148 percent to US$3,499,000 ($0.24 per share) compared to US$1,413,000 ($0.11 per share) in the previous year. For the first six months, revenues increased nearly fivefold to US$70,941,000 in fiscal 1999 compared to US$14,403,000 last year. Net earnings excluding foreign exchange gains and losses rose almost threefold to US$6,460,000 compared to US$2,193,000 in the corresponding 1998 period. "We are very pleased with our second quarter results and our continuing success in building a sustainable and expanding revenue base in high-growth sectors of the information technology industry," said Ronald Brisebois, President and Chief Executive Officer. "Our earnings growth demonstrates our ability to successfully integrate acquisitions, exploit cross-selling opportunities to increase revenues and achieve cost synergies to maintain strong margins." During the second quarter and subsequently, three acquisitions were completed, two in Canada and one in France. The aggregate annual revenues of these three companies prior to acquisition totaled about US$17 million. With their integration and internal growth, COGNICASE's revenue run rate currently stands at approximately US$150 million. Year 2000 solutions represented less than 12 percent of revenues in the second quarter, reflecting the strength and diversification of the Company's revenue mix. This compares with 15 percent in the first quarter of fiscal 1999 and 21 percent in the fourth quarter of the previous year. The Company expects continued decline in this business as a percentage of revenues subsequent quarters. Founded in 1991, COGNICASE is an international provider of value- added information technology consulting services, solutions and software. The Company offers a full range of IT solutions including outsourcing, ERP implementation, application development, WEB/E-commerce development, network architecture, management and application development software for client/server and Web-based application, as well as software for automated software conversion, platform migration and IT outsourcing. COGNICASE has over 1,900 resources serving customers from business offices in 15 cities in North America, Europe and Australia.
